I am honored to serve as the vice president of a non-profit called FamAlly Cares Inc. The 501 (c)(3) nonprofit was organized and supported by Alliance RV owners. We are dedicated to helping children and families in the Elkhart, Indiana community, as well as children and families associated with the larger camping community through various fundraising events. FamAlly Cares Inc exists to serve the RV community and to help when there is a need. Not just within the Alliance family, but across all brands because RVers belong to one united family.
At the Alliance national rally FamAlly Cares facilitates the Welcome Event for rally attendees to include welcome bags, food, and games, We also run the rally raffle and silent auction fundraiser. This fundraiser enables us to provide several scholarships and charitable donations each year and help for families in need
So today we met some new friends, Kim & Jason Anderson, who volunteered to help us with the rally raffle table. We get significant RV-related items donated by our vendors. Rally attendees will get raffle tickets in their welcome bags as well as earn them playing games and visiting the vendors. They place ticket stubs in the chosen buckets we provide for each item and at the end of the rally we will draw from each bucket for the winners.
I also provide board interface with the volunteers that assemble the rally attendee welcome bags, provide the rally welcome event dinner and the games. The planning for the next rally starts right after this one ends, and there is a lot of behind the scenes work to make all this happen.
